Expert Review
This cashier role with JobleticsPro offers flexibility, ttractive for those balancing other commitments. Flexible scheduling is a major plus, allowing workers to choose shifts that fit their lifestyle. However, the fast-paced environment could be challenging for those unaccustomed to high-pressure situations.
Customer service is at the forefront of this position, which means employees must be ready to interact positively with diverse customers while ensuring accurate transactions. This focus can lead to rewarding experiences, but it can also create stress during peak hours.
Job seekers should be aware that while the pay is not specified, retail positions often offer competitive wages, typically starting around minimum wage. According to JobleticsPro's page, this role is part-time, which may limit benefits compared to full-time positions. Those looking for steady, full-time work may find this role lacking in stability.
Overall, this cashier position is a solid opportunity for those seeking flexibility. However, it may not be the best fit for individuals wanting a predictable work schedule or career advancement.
